Bergen County Hero Dies Saving Friends in Poconos Kayak Accident

Screenshot 2025 05 26 212732

the staff of the Ridgewood blog

Norwood NJ, a Bergen County man tragically drowned on May 25 while heroically attempting to save two friends whose kayak had overturned in a small lake in the Pocono Mountains.

According to the Pocono Mountain Regional Police, Bibin Michael, 40, of Norwood, NJ, entered the water without a life jacket after seeing two people fall out of their kayak. The incident occurred around 12:30 p.m. behind homes near Sir Bradford Road in Blakeslee, Pennsylvania.

Anti Development Hackensack Unites Slate Sweeps City Council Election in a Major Upset

welcome to hackensackjpg 57ac95460fc95b711

the staff of the Ridgewood blog

Hackensack NJ,  in a historic political shift, the Hackensack Unites slate won a decisive victory in the May 13 City Council election, unseating incumbent Mayor John Labrosse and his entire ticket. All five council seats up for grabs were claimed by the challengers, signaling a dramatic change in the city’s leadership and development priorities.

End of an Era: Historic Tenafly Movie Theater Demolished to Make Way for Housing

LY4DYWJA42GBUB15K1SSPSFOLWKCBR2LB2HUOIT5AMRCF3K1 2391385312

the staff of the Ridgewood blog

Tenafly NJ, the curtains have officially closed on one of Bergen County’s historic landmarks. The former Bow Tie Cinemas on Railroad Avenue in Tenafly is being demolished, bringing an end to over a century of cinematic history. The site will soon be transformed into residential housing, according to Tenafly Police Chief Robert Chamberlain.
